The capsular material from Lactobacillus plantarum IMB19, an isolate from fermented vegetables, has been analyzed and our results demonstrate that most of the coat of this bacterium consists of glycerol- and ribitol-type teichoic acids, further decorated with other substituents (α-glucose and alanine), and of a capsular polysaccharide (CPS) with a linear nonasaccharide repeating unit, rich in rhamnose, interconnected to the next via a phosphodiester bridge.

Pasteurella multocida is the etiological agent responsible for several diseases in a wide range of hosts around the world and thus, causes serious economic losses. Acute septicemia associated with capsular type B P. multocida has recently emerged in Europe and continuous outbreaks of these acute processes have been described in Spain since they were first detected in pigs in 2009 and cattle in 2015.

Streptococcus agalactiae (Group B Streptococcus, GBS) is one of the major bacterial pathogens responsible for neonatal sepsis. Whole genome sequencing has, in recent years, emerged as a reliable tool for capsular typing and antimicrobial resistance prediction.

Haemophilus influenzae (Hi) can cause invasive diseases such as meningitis, pneumonia, or sepsis. Typeable Hi includes six serotypes (a through f), each expressing a unique capsular polysaccharide. The capsule, encoded by the genes within the capsule locus, is a major virulence factor of typeable Hi. Non-typeable (NTHi) does not express capsule and is associated with invasive and non-invasive diseases.

The present study was implemented to evaluate S. aureus for their 2 major capsular polysaccharide genes namely cap5k and cap8k. Capsule is an important virulence factor of S. aureus which help the organism in its survival by evading host immune system specially phagocytosis.

The present investigation was designed to determine the frequency of capsular polysaccharide genes (cap5 & cap8) in Staphylococcus aureus strains isolated from raw milk samples of various regions of Jaipur, the capital city of Rajasthan state of India. In this study presence of S. aureus and cap5and cap8 gene was evaluated by Polymerase Chain Reaction.

A recent study that examined multiple strains ofCampylobacter jejuni reported that HS:19, a serostrain that has been associated with the onset of Guillain–Barre´ syndrome, had unidentified labile, capsular polysaccharide (CPS) structures. In this study, we expand on this observation by using current glyco-analytical technologies to characterize these unknown groups.

Evasion of Host Defense Mechanisms Evasion of host defense mechanisms is critical to invasion. Staphylococci possess an antiphagocytic polysaccharide microcapsule. Most human S. aureus infections are due to capsular types 5 and 8. The S. aureus capsule also plays a role in the induction of abscess formation. The capsular polysaccharides are characterized by a zwitterionic charge pattern (the presence of both negatively and positively charged molecules) that is critical to abscess formation. Protein A, an MSCRAMM unique to S. aureus, acts as an Fc receptor.
